Serie A Feminine: Echegini's brace help Juventus beat Inter Milan

Published on: 15 February 2024

Nigeria Super Falcons attacking midfielder, Onyinyechi Echegini was the heroine as Juventus got the better of rivals, Inter Milan in the Serie A Feminine on Wednesday night, Nigeriasoccernet.com reports.

Echegini scored 2 goals in the first half to help Juventus to a 2-0 Derby d'Italia win away from home at the Arena Civica Gianni Brera.

Her first goal came in the 7th minute after she initiated a fine build up which led to a cross by Maëlle Garbino which was perfectly headed in by Echegini.

The second goal came seven minutes later in similar fashion as another Garbino cross found an onrushing Echegini who made no mistake to tap the ball in.

Juventus held on to the win despite the home sides push for a goal in the second half. A win that keeps their second spot in tact after 17 matches.

Echegini has now scored 4 goals in 6 appearances since joining the white and black team in January this year.
